The Range Rover Sport is going electric, but Land Rover does not appear to be giving its luxury SUV a dramatic EV makeover. As reported by Motor1, the Range Rover Sport Electric will look very close to the combustion-engined model when it makes its full debut later this year. The biggest exterior changes are expected to be a closed-off grille and the removal of exhaust tips.
Keeping the existing shape should help the electric version appeal to buyers who already like the Range Rover Sport’s design. While some manufacturers use new EVs to experiment with unusual styling, Land Rover seems happy to let the electric powertrain provide the biggest difference.
The Range Rover Sport Electric is expected to use the same Modular Longitudinal Architecture as the petrol and plug-in hybrid models. Since the platform was developed to support several types of powertrain, the electric Sport can join the existing range without forcing Land Rover to completely rethink the SUV.
Power will reportedly come from a dual-motor setup, with either 444hp or 542hp depending on the version. Both motors are expected to be identical, creating a 50:50 split between the front and rear axles.
A 118.5kWh battery is reportedly planned, with Land Rover targeting an EPA range of around 330 miles. The electric Sport is also expected to use an 800-volt system and support DC charging at up to 350kW, although Land Rover has not confirmed the final figures yet.
Land Rover also appears determined to preserve the Sport’s off-road ability as it moves to electric power. Air suspension, rear-wheel steering and a one-pedal driving mode designed to work beyond paved roads are all expected to carry over.
The cabin is also likely to remain close to the current Range Rover Sport, with the same premium materials and screen-led layout. Full interior details have not yet been confirmed.
Pricing has not been announced, but Land Rover has already said its EVs will carry a premium over their combustion-engined equivalents. Visually, however, the electric Sport is expected to stay deliberately close to the current version.
